Integrated Feedback Collection Systems

In-Game Feedback Tools

Implement feedback buttons during natural gameplay breaks. Place collection points after level completion, deaths, or achievement unlocks. Timing determines response quality and quantity.

Use contextual prompts that relate to current player experience. Ask about difficulty during challenging sections. Query monetization feelings after purchase attempts. Context drives relevant responses.

Optimal Feedback Trigger Points:

  • After tutorial completion (onboarding clarity)
  • Following first death (difficulty balance)
  • Post-level completion (content satisfaction)
  • During loading screens (performance issues)
  • After in-app purchase flows (monetization feedback)

Targeted Feedback Techniques

Player Segmentation Approaches

Segment feedback collection by player behavior patterns. New players need onboarding feedback forms. Experienced players require depth and balance questions. Paying customers focus on value perception.

Behavioral Trigger Systems

Implement feedback requests based on specific player actions. Trigger surveys after app crashes. Ask about difficulty after multiple failed attempts. Query satisfaction after successful achievements.

Use machine learning to identify optimal feedback moments. Analyze player stress indicators like rapid tapping or session abandonment. Request feedback during calm gameplay periods.

Data Processing and Analysis

Automated Sentiment Analysis

Use natural language processing tools to analyze feedback sentiment. Categorize responses as positive, negative, or neutral automatically. Identify trending issues across large feedback volumes.

Tools like Google Cloud Natural Language API or AWS Comprehend process thousands of responses quickly. Automated analysis reveals patterns human reviewers miss.

Feedback Categorization Systems

Create standardized categories for feedback organization. Group responses by game systems like UI, gameplay, monetization, or technical issues. Systematic organization enables priority identification.

Priority Scoring Framework

Develop scoring systems that weigh feedback based on player value and issue severity. High-spending players and long-term users receive increased priority weights. Critical bugs outrank feature requests.

Calculate feedback impact scores using player lifetime value, engagement metrics, and issue frequency. Focus development resources on high-impact improvements first.

Response and Action Strategies

Feedback Acknowledgment

Respond to feedback within 24 hours when possible. Acknowledgment builds player trust and encourages future participation. Thank players for specific insights and detail implementation plans.

Create public feedback roadmaps showing implemented suggestions. Players who see their ideas implemented become loyal advocates. Transparent communication builds stronger communities.

Implementation Communication

Announce feedback-driven improvements in patch notes and social media. Credit players who suggested implemented features. Recognition encourages continued community participation.

Track and share metrics showing feedback impact. Demonstrate how player suggestions improved key performance indicators. Data validation builds community trust in the feedback process.
